The Neural Architecture of Theory-based Reinforcement Learning

2022-06-16

Abstract excerpt

Humans learn internal models of the environment that support efficient planning and flexible generalization in complex, real-world domains. Yet it remains unclear how such internal models are represented and learned in the brain.
